DENTAL CHECKUPS FOR MIGRANT CHILDREN



One of the services Asha-Kiran provides for the children of construction workers is Dental checkup and treatment Camps. For the second year in a row, we offered this service at the construction sites we are associated with, where our Day Care Centers also provide daytime shelter, informal schooling and nutrition for children who would otherwise have no access to medical care.

The objective of the camps is to improve the oral health of the children and adults who live in construction communities by providing quality dental care services.

Our one-day dental camps were set up in collaboration with D.Y. Patil Hospital Pimpri-Chinchwad, Pune, for children aged 3-18, as well as for the parents who work and live at the sites. We covered 186 children and adults at Marvel Bounty, Marvel Arco, Marvel Citrin, Cerise, and Cascada developments. All the patients were screened and treated in a well-equipped Mobile Dental Clinic. Depending on each case, treatment consisted of fillings, extractions, or a course of specific medication.
